Understanding Your Auto Insurance Policy

Protecting your vehicle and yourself on the road demands a comprehensive auto insurance policy. Though, many individuals struggle to fully understand their coverage details.

To avoid unexpected financial burdens, it's crucial to review your policy carefully. Begin by pinpointing the different types of insurance offered: liability coverage, collision coverage, comprehensive coverage, and uninsured/underinsured driver protection.

Each component plays a distinct role in safeguarding you against various dangers. Liability insurance helps reimburse damages or injuries you may cause on others. Collision coverage covers harm to your vehicle in the event of an accident, while comprehensive coverage safeguards against non-collision situations, such as theft or vandalism. Uninsured/underinsured motorist protection provides monetary support if you're impacted in an accident with a driver who lacks adequate insurance.

Recognizing your policy boundaries is equally important. Pay heed to deductibles, which are the figures you're responsible to pay out-of-pocket before insurance coverage kicks in. Additionally, familiarize yourself with any exclusions that may restrict your coverage.

Tips for Choosing Affordable Car Insurance

Finding the right car insurance doesn't be a headache, even if your budget is tight. Here are some tricks to help you find a policy that satisfies your needs without breaking your bank account. First, compare quotes from several different providers. Don't just go with the first one you find; take some time to explore your options and find what's available.

Next, evaluate raising your deductible. This is the amount of money you contribute out-of-pocket before your insurance kicks in. Increasing your deductible can often result a lower premium. Just make sure you have enough money saved up to cover the deductible if you require file a claim.

You can also explore for discounts. Many insurers offer breaks for things like good driving records, multiple cars insured, or even having a security system in your vehicle. Group your car insurance with other policies, such as renters or homeowners insurance, to often reduce money. Finally, keep in mind that driving habits and conditions like your age and location can all affect your premium.
